Take a look at this video. Regardless of how you feel about Here Comes Honey Boo-Boo, regardless of how you feel about the Thompson family, and regardless of how you feel about Dr. Drew, there are two very basic things at work here that have passed the point of acceptability:
1. If Alana Thompson is just pretending to be asleep, she’s being super rude.
While it’s true that Thompson probably has a busier schedule than most seven-year-olds, I don’t see how that excuses her from learning the basics of how to behave when taking up someone else’s time. June Thompson has very smartly opened trust funds for her daughters so that they can take advantage of other opportunities the show has opened up for them. However. Learning how to be polite company is also an investment in a person’s future. The Thompsons should forfeit the right to continue to promote themselves (which is, after all, what they’re doing in all of these interviews) until that happens. I realize this is unlikely, since these bizarre interviews are great publicity for the interviewers as well, but a girl can dream.
2. If Alana Thompson is actually falling asleep, maybe it’s time to stop doing interviews.
I mean, really.
There you have it! These two possibilities have made it impossible for me to find any redemptive qualities in the Thompson clan or the show — if it’s the first one, then they’re doing their kid a disservice by not correcting her behavior, and if it’s the second it starts to feel like their family/Alana’s childhood is being exploited for material gain, even if that comes with an greater amount of opportunity later on. I have to wonder if it’s worth it.
